Common Building Damage Repair Jobs
Roof Damage Repair - restores roofing structures after storms, leaks, or falling debris.
Foundation Restoration - addresses cracks, shifting, or settling to ensure stability.
Wall and Ceiling Repair - fixes cracks, holes, and water damage to maintain interior integrity.
Siding Replacement - replaces damaged or deteriorated siding to protect the exterior.
Window and Door Repair - restores functionality and seals to improve energy efficiency.
Structural Damage Repair - reinforces or rebuilds compromised framing and load-bearing elements.
Building Damage Repair Questions
What types of building damage can be repaired? Damage caused by storms, leaks, or structural issues can be addressed, including roof, wall, and foundation repairs.
How are repairs handled for different property types? Services are tailored to residential and commercial buildings to ensure proper restoration and safety.
What signs indicate the need for building damage repair? Visible cracks, water stains, sagging structures, or unusual noises may signal damage requiring attention.
What should property owners consider before repairs? It's important to assess the extent of damage and ensure proper documentation for insurance purposes if applicable.
